📋 Understanding Local Business Licensing and Planning Permissions in Deskford

⚖️ Essential Legal Framework for Hospitality Property Ownership

Navigating Deskford's regulatory environment requires understanding specific licensing requirements and planning considerations that affect hospitality business operations and property values within this Deskford Hospitality Business property For sale or rent guide.

🏛️ Tourism Licensing Requirements
Moray Council requires tourism accommodation licenses for properties hosting paying guests. Applications typically take 6-8 weeks, requiring fire safety certificates, public liability insurance, and compliance with accessibility standards. Annual renewal fees range from £150-£400 depending on property size.

🏗️ Change of Use Permissions
Converting residential properties to commercial hospitality use requires planning permission. Most village properties already hold appropriate classifications, but extensions or significant modifications need council approval. Conservation area restrictions may apply to historic buildings.

🪧 Signage and Advertising Regulations
Business signage requires planning consent, with specific guidelines for conservation areas. Traditional Scottish styling is encouraged, while illuminated signs face restrictions. Digital advertising boards are generally prohibited in residential areas.

🔊 Noise and Operating Restrictions
Evening entertainment and outdoor activities must comply with noise regulations. Most properties operate under standard residential noise limits, with special event permissions available for occasional functions. Garden areas and parking arrangements require consideration of neighbor impact.

💳 Financing Your Deskford Hospitality Business Property

🏦 Comprehensive Guide to Hospitality Property Investment Funding

Securing appropriate financing for hospitality property investment requires understanding specialized lending products and preparing comprehensive business cases that demonstrate viability and profitability potential within Deskford's tourism market.

🏛️ Commercial Mortgage Options
Specialist hospitality lenders offer commercial mortgages with terms typically ranging from 15-25 years at interest rates 1-2% above residential rates. Loan-to-value ratios generally reach 70-75% for established businesses, requiring 25-30% deposit plus additional working capital. Lenders evaluate both property value and business performance when assessing applications.

💼 Business Acquisition Loans
When purchasing existing operations, business acquisition loans consider goodwill, customer base, and trading history alongside property value. These facilities often provide higher borrowing capacity but require detailed financial due diligence including three years of accounts, profit and loss statements, and forward business projections.

📊 Financial Documentation Requirements
Lenders typically require comprehensive business plans including market analysis, competition assessment, marketing strategies, and five-year financial projections. Personal financial statements, credit history, and hospitality industry experience significantly influence lending decisions and interest rate negotiations.

🎯 Alternative Funding Sources
Government grants support rural business development and sustainable tourism initiatives. The Scottish Government's Rural Tourism Infrastructure Fund provides grants up to £100,000 for qualifying projects. Crowdfunding platforms increasingly support hospitality ventures, while private investors seek opportunities in Scotland's growing tourism sector.

💡 Financial Planning Strategies
Successful buyers typically maintain 6-12 months operating expenses in reserve funds beyond purchase requirements. Seasonal cash flow variations require careful financial planning, with many operators establishing credit facilities to manage working capital fluctuations during quieter periods.

🔍 Professional Advisory Services
Specialist hospitality accountants and business brokers provide valuable guidance throughout the acquisition process. Their industry knowledge helps identify potential issues, negotiate favorable terms, and structure deals for optimal tax efficiency and operational success.

🏠 Popular Hospitality Business Property Types Available in Deskford

🏨 Comprehensive Breakdown of Investment Opportunities

The diverse range of hospitality properties available in Deskford caters to different investment strategies and operational preferences, each offering unique advantages for business development and guest experience delivery.

🏡 Traditional Bed & Breakfasts
Typically featuring 4-6 guest rooms in converted family homes, these properties offer intimate guest experiences with owner-operator potential. Average room sizes of 12-15 square meters include en-suite facilities, with communal dining areas and guest lounges. Gardens and parking for 6-8 vehicles are standard features.

🏰 Boutique Guesthouses
Larger Victorian or Edwardian properties converted to accommodate 8-12 guests in premium surroundings. These establishments often feature period architectural details, spacious public areas, and extensive grounds. Professional management systems and higher service standards command premium room rates.

🍺 Historic Coaching Inns
Traditional Scottish inns combining accommodation with restaurant and bar facilities. These properties typically offer 6-10 guest rooms above public areas, with established local trade supporting year-round viability. Licensing for alcohol sales provides additional revenue streams.

🌱 Eco-Lodge Developments
Modern sustainable accommodation targeting environmentally conscious travelers. These properties feature renewable energy systems, locally sourced materials, and minimal environmental impact design. Growing market segment with premium pricing potential and grant funding opportunities available.

🚗 Getting to Deskford: Travel Infrastructure and Access Routes

🗺️ Strategic Location Advantages for Hospitality Business Success

Deskford's excellent transport connectivity creates significant advantages for hospitality businesses, ensuring easy guest access while positioning properties within Scotland's premier tourism circuits that drive consistent visitor demand.

🛣️ Road Access
The A98 coastal route provides direct access from Aberdeen (45 minutes) and connects to the A96 trunk road serving Edinburgh and Glasgow. Scenic Highland routes attract touring visitors who often extend stays when discovering local attractions.

🚂 Railway Connections
Keith railway station (8 miles) offers direct services to Aberdeen, Inverness, and central Scotland. Many visitors combine train travel with local exploration, creating opportunities for extended stays and package deals with transport providers.

✈️ Airport Proximity
Aberdeen Airport (45 minutes) serves major UK cities and European destinations, while Inverness Airport (90 minutes) provides additional access routes. Both airports offer car rental facilities supporting self-drive tourism.

🚌 Public Transport
Regular bus services connect Deskford to regional centers, while specialized tour operators include the village in Highland touring circuits. This connectivity supports visitors without private transport and creates referral opportunities.

🎯 Tourism Route Integration
Deskford sits on established touring routes including the Malt Whisky Trail and Coastal Trail, ensuring consistent passing trade and opportunities for partnership marketing with regional attractions and tour operators.
